#74d5c0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#74d5c0 is composed of 45.5% red, 83.5%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 167 degrees, a saturation of 53.6% and a lightness of 64.5%. #74d5c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ffff with #00ab81.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#74d5c0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#74d5c0 has RGB values of R:116, G:213,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 7656896.

Shades and Tints of #74d5c0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c0a is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#74d5c0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9eaba8 is the less saturated color, while #4affd8 is the most saturated one.
